Does Amazon track computer activity?

The company defends the decision citing instances when hackers or imposters might have accessed a worker's account to steal customer information. Amazon will monitor the keyboard and mouse movements of its customer service employees in an effort to thwart imposters or hackers trying to access customer data.

How do I hide Amazon purchases and search?

Find the order you want to hide and click View order details, then Archive Order. Click Archive Order again to confirm. This will remove the item from immediate viewing within your order history. Note: Archived orders can still be viewed by going to the Your Account page and selecting Archived orders.

Can you hide Amazon purchase history?

Amazon's leaves your purchase history readily accessible through the “Returns & Orders” tab at the top of every page. But you can easily hide orders on Amazon from prying eyes by archiving them. When you archive an order, it doesn't show up in your regular orders list on the Your Orders page.

Does Amazon track mouse movement?

Instead, the system generates a profile based on the employee's natural keyboard and mouse movements, and then continuously verifies whether it seems the same person is in control of the worker's account to catch hackers or imposters who may then steal data.
